摘要

一些研究已经证实,人工耳蜗(CI)听众依靠音乐的节奏来判断音乐的情感内容。然而,对一项研究的重新分析显示,在这项研究中,CI听众从快乐到悲伤的程度上判断钢琴作品所传达的情感,节奏和情感之间的相关性很弱。本研究探讨了音乐中的时间线索对正常听力听者情绪判断的影响,为理解CI听者使用的时间线索提供了新的思路。实验1复制了Vannson等人对NH听众的研究,使用康加斯创造的钢琴节奏模式。时间线索被保留,而音调线索被删除。结果表明:(1)节奏与情绪判断呈弱相关;(2)NH听众对康加舞的判断与CI听众对钢琴的判断相似。在实验2中,两项任务以三种不同的节奏播放:情绪判断和记录听者感知节奏的敲击任务。感知到的节奏比节奏更能预测,但它的物理相关性,即平均起病时间差(MOOD),一种衡量音符之间平均时间的指标,与NH听众的情绪判断产生了更高的相关性。这一结果表明,听众依靠连续音符之间的平均时间来判断音乐的情感内容,而不是节奏。CI听众可以利用这个线索来判断音乐的情感内容。

Temporal Cues in the Judgment of Music Emotion for Normal and Cochlear Implant Listeners.

Several studies have established that Cochlear implant (CI) listeners rely on the tempo of music to judge the emotional content of music. However, a re-analysis of a study in which CI listeners judged the emotion conveyed by piano pieces on a scale from happy to sad revealed a weak correlation between tempo and emotion. The present study explored which temporal cues in music influence emotion judgments among normal hearing (NH) listeners, which might provide insights into the cues utilized by CI listeners. Experiment 1 was a replication of the Vannson et al. study with NH listeners using rhythmic patterns of piano created with congas. The temporal cues were preserved while the tonal ones were removed. The results showed (i) tempo was weakly correlated with emotion judgments, (ii) NH listeners' judgments for congas were similar to CI listeners' judgments for piano. In Experiment 2, two tasks were administered with congas played at three different tempi: emotion judgment and a tapping task to record listeners' perceived tempo. Perceived tempo was a better predictor than the tempo, but its physical correlate, mean onset-to-onset difference (MOOD), a measure of the average time between notes, yielded higher correlations with NH listeners' emotion judgments. This result suggests that instead of the tempo, listeners rely on the average time between consecutive notes to judge the emotional content of music. CI listeners could utilize this cue to judge the emotional content of music.
